Mixed-ligand strategy afforded two new metal-organic frameworks (MOFs), namely [Ni(L)(0.5)(4,4'-bipy)(0.5)(H2O)(2)](n) (1) and [Zn-2(L)(bpp)(2)](n) (2) (H4L = 1,3-di(3',5'-dicarboxylphenyl)benzene, 4,4'-bipy = 4,4' -bipyridine and bpp = 1,3-di(4-pyridyl)propane), which were further characterized by elemental analyses, powder X-ray diffraction analyses and single crystal X-ray diffraction analyses. Compound 1 features a 4-fold interpenetrated 3D framework with (3,4)-connected dmd-type topology, and compound 2 features a 3D complicated framework with 4 -connected topology. Moreover, the photocatalytic activity of compound 1 for the degradation of methyl blue (MB) and luminescent property of compound 2 were investigated in detail. In addition, the anti-lung cancer activities of both complexes have been evaluated via the MTT assay against three human lung cancer cells A549, H1299 and PC9. (C) 2018 Elsevier B.V.
